Detalles del Curso

โ€ข Introduction to Nanomaterials
โ€ข Nanomaterials in Civil Infrastructure
โ€ข Synthesis and Characterization of Nanomaterials
โ€ข Properties of Nanomaterials for Infrastructure Resilience
โ€ข Nanotechnology-based Approaches to Infrastructure Rehabilitation
โ€ข Nano-enhanced Concrete and Cementitious Materials
โ€ข Nanocoatings and Corrosion Protection
โ€ข Sensors and Monitoring in Nanomaterial-based Infrastructure
โ€ข Environmental and Safety Considerations of Nanomaterials
โ€ข Case Studies on Nanomaterials for Infrastructure Resilience
